We are a new psychotherapy practice, with availability in person in Greenpoint and virtually. We specialize in affirming and culturally-attuned mental health care for the queer, South and East Asian communities of NYC.
We believe that connection is at the center of healing and growth: connection to ourselves, our loved ones, and our broader community. We specialize in emotions-focused, trauma-informed and somatically-attuned therapy.

Rishika Singh - "I am a queer South Asian New Yorker. In founding millow, I aimed to bring the kind of therapy I found to be most deeply healing to my own community, whose unique perspectives and challenges are rarely centered in traditional therapy practice."
I am an LCSW, practicing for 7 years.
I am AEDP Level 2 Certified, and have completed Queer and Trans IFS training.
I have 5 years of training in therapy with LGBTQ clients, folks living with HIV, and gender affirming care through my work at the Institute for Contemporary Psychotherapy and Callen-Lorde Community Health Center.
